We've been buying this style of shoe for almost two years now. With other styles, my son would put his tongue in that area, but with this style that wasn't possible. My son is not good with shoes so the frequency of their purchase doesn't bother me. Also, the size increase didn't bother me until these showed up. The insole offered almost no cushioning. The back of the heel was stiff, almost like women's shoes. Also NO padding at the top of the back of the shoe under the ankle. I'm afraid it could cause blisters. I chose this style for a reason and as the size went up the quality went down. While my son (7 years old and on the autism spectrum) is enjoying his new shoes I am a little disappointed.
